by Joseph H. Ladd (Author), Jason R. Carpenter (Editor)

The farm does not lie. You plant in the spring what you hope to harvest in the fall, and the soil gives you back exactly what your labor and the weather and the worms allow.

For forty-seven years, Dr. Joseph H. Ladd served as superintendent of the Rhode Island School for the Feeble-Minded in Exeter, overseeing thousands committed to the State's care. Drawn from official reports, institutional letters, and records no one was meant to read again, House Dogs in the Turnips resurrects his voice as a posthumous memoir written in the aftermath of a murder accusation that brought his career to an end.

A work of disability history and true crime memoir.
